Macron Makes Historic Syria Visit Under New Leadership

Rebuilding Relations: A Delicate Balance

French President Emmanuel Macron arrived in Syria on Monday, marking the first major visit by a Western leader since Bashar al-Assad's ousting in December 2024. Macron's trip is seen as a significant diplomatic move, with the French leader set to attend the Nato summit in Ankara afterwards.

The visit comes as Syria's new leadership, under President Ahmad al-Sharaa, seeks to rebuild the country's international ties. Macron's presence is expected to signal a shift in Western engagement with Syria, as the country navigates its post-conflict era.

Macron's visit is a crucial step in re-establishing diplomatic channels with Syria. The French President is likely to discuss issues such as reconstruction, security, and humanitarian aid. Syrian officials have welcomed Macron's visit, indicating a willingness to engage with the West.

Can Syria's New Leadership Secure Western Support?

The success of Macron's visit will depend on the Syrian government's ability to demonstrate its commitment to reform and stability. Western leaders will be watching closely to see if Ahmad al-Sharaa's administration can deliver on its promises.

As Macron travels to Ankara for the Nato summit, the international community will be assessing the implications of his Syria visit. The French leader's engagement with Syria's new leadership may pave the way for increased Western investment and cooperation.
